Experience the true essence of Nadi on this carefully designed half-day cultural and nature tour, perfect for visitors with limited time who want to see the best of Fiji. Your journey begins with a visit to the Sri Siva Subramaniya Swami Temple, the largest Hindu temple in the Southern Hemisphere. Admire its colorful architecture and learn about its cultural and spiritual significance. Next, enjoy shopping at Jack’s of Fiji, where you can browse a wide range of local souvenirs, handicrafts, clothing, and gifts — ideal for taking a piece of Fiji back home. Continue to the lively Namaka Local Market, where you’ll experience authentic Fijian daily life. Here, guests have the opportunity to try traditional kava and enjoy fresh coconut water, offering a true taste of local culture. The tour then takes you to the serene Garden of the Sleeping Giant, famous for its beautiful orchid collection, tropical rainforest paths, and peaceful surroundings — a perfect spot for nature lovers and photography. Your final stop is the relaxing Sabeto Mud Pools and Hot Springs, where you can enjoy a natural spa experience. Cover yourself in mineral-rich mud and unwind in the warm thermal pools, leaving you refreshed and rejuvenated.
